Publisher's Synopsis

The field's definitive reference.
You understand the critical place exercise testing occupies in the clinical decision-making process. It's an important step before carrying out more complex, costly, or invasive procedures. For nearly ten years, one reference has been the definitive source for everything the practitioner needs to know about exercise testing: Exercise and the Heart. And now, this outstanding reference is available in a newly updated 4th Edition.
The complete practice-oriented text.
This remarkable new 4th Edition contains the latest information on every aspect of exercise testing. You'll get in-depth descriptions of standard exercise tests, including protocols, methods, interpretation, and prognosis. The entire range of applications is covered in detail, from diagnostic uses to post-MI evaluation. You'll also get a complete look at the most important new technologies and techniques, including computerized electrocardiography, exercise training in cardiac rehabilitation, and ventilatory gas exchange. And every chapter features outstanding illustrations, tables, and nomograms that spotlight important points.
